    Mesothelioma Compensation

    The expenses associated with mesothelioma pile up quickly. The compensation from a lawsuit, trust fund or VA benefits can help offset the costs.

    A reputable mesothelioma lawyer will examine your work or military history to determine where and when exposure to asbestos is likely to have occurred. They can also explain the different kinds of compensation.

    How Much Money Will I Receive?

    Asbestos victims can receive compensation for past and future medical expenses and lost wages, as well as pain and suffering, and other damages. The amount of money awarded depends on the victim's individual circumstances. Patients with mesothelioma could also be entitled to punitive damages. These are additional compensations that are made to punish defendants. An experienced mesothelioma lawyer can assist clients in determining whether a settlement or trial is the best option for them.

    An experienced lawyer can help clients receive the most amount of compensation. However, attorneys cannot promise a specific settlement amount. There are many variables to consider, such as the mesothelioma patient's specific type and how long they have been diagnosed with the disease. The amount of compensation received may be affected by the number of asbestos companies that are held responsible.

    Most mesothelioma cases are settled instead of going to trial. Taking a case to trial can take years. A trial permits a jury to determine whether defendants are owed compensation from the victims and how much they are due.

    In addition to the monetary compensation, patients suffering from mesothelioma and other asbestos-related diseases can be eligible for benefits from the U.S. Department of Veterans Affairs. These benefits may include access to the best mesothelioma doctors and disability compensation. Veterans can get help by a lawyer for their VA claims.

    A veteran's attorney can also help them file personal injury lawsuits against the asbestos settlement-related companies responsible for mesothelioma and other disease. A mesothelioma case is not a replacement for filing a VA claim.

    Who can receive compensation?

    Asbestos victims who have been diagnosed with mesothelioma or another asbestos legal-related disease may be eligible for compensation. Asbestos lawyers can assist the victims and their loved ones in filing claims for mesothelioma against liable asbestos companies. Compensation can be obtained by filing trust fund claims for bankruptcy and settling lawsuits, or winning a trial verdict.

    A skilled mesothelioma lawyer can assist in determining which form of compensation is appropriate for each case. This will depend on the place and time of the exposure, the kind of symptoms that the patient suffers from due to mesothelioma, and whether the victim worked for a company that had an asbestos settlement trust fund.

    Mesothelioma suits can be filed under the personal injury law or the laws governing wrongful deaths. Compensation is designed to provide victims with the financial aid they require. Compensation for mesothelioma lawsuits could be substantial and include both economic and other damages. In addition, if it can be proven that a mesothelioma-producing company was negligent or acted with malice and concealment, punitive damages could also be awarded.

    Patients suffering from asbestos-related diseases, such as mesothelioma, who receive a settlement or a verdict at trial, can be compensated for medical expenses, funeral costs as well as lost income and suffering and pain. Asbestosis, mesothelioma, and other asbestos-related illnesses sufferers have the right to claim loss of consortium.

    In certain instances, veterans who served in the US military prior to 1980 could be eligible for mesothelioma compensation through the Department of Veterans Affairs. This is because the military employed large amounts of asbestos in its vessels and buildings prior to the 1980s. Veterans comprise 30% of mesothelioma patients. The VA provides financial assistance to cover medical expenses and disability benefits, as well as a pension based on the severity of the disease.

    A few victims and their families could decide that the settlement or lawsuit may be a better alternative to trust funds. A successful trial can result in a higher amount of money. However going to trial is some risk. However, a mesothelioma lawyer can help prepare the case for trial by negotiating with the lawyer representing the defendant and studying occupational histories. A mesothelioma lawyer can help set goals for the case and provide explanations of different compensation options.

    How do I file a Claim?

    A legal claim can assist families and victims pay for mesothelioma treatments. Compensation may be granted through a settlement, asbestos fund payout or a trial verdict.

    A patient with mesothelioma should consult a mesothelioma attorney to determine the best option for them, whether it is a lawsuit against asbestos or a different compensation option. A mesothelioma law firm will aid the victims and their families determine which companies to choose as defendants and where the asbestos exposure occurred. The mesothelioma lawsuit must be filed within the prescribed time of limitations.

    The most frequent types of mesothelioma claims are personal injury or wrongful death claims. These claims seek to recover compensation from asbestos manufacturers to compensate victims for asbestos-related illnesses and losses. In the event that mesothelioma or a similar asbestos-related illness, caused the death of loved loved ones, wrongful deaths claims can be filed.

    Mesothelioma sufferers and their families could be eligible for compensation through workers' compensation, but this type of compensation isn't often enough to cover all the expenses related to mesothelioma treatment. The deadlines for filing workers' compensation claims differ from statutes of limitations for suing asbestos litigation companies and some states permit employers to decline coverage for occupational diseases like mesothelioma.

    People with mesothelioma and other asbestos-related illnesses can make a claim for disability benefits from the Department of Veterans Affairs (VA). The VA gives access to the best mesothelioma specialists in the world as well as the right to receive compensation for living expenses. VA disability benefits are available in addition to a mesothelioma suit or asbestos trust fund claim.

    A mesothelioma attorney can offer a patient an initial consultation to help them decide what kind of claim they need to file and the amount of compensation they are entitled to. A lawyer can also handle the complicated paperwork involved and make sure that the paperwork is filed correctly and on time. They can also gather all medical records and other evidence to support mesothelioma cases.

    What kind of compensation is Available?

    Compensation for mesothelioma may provide a wide array of expenses. Compensation may include medical bills, loss of wages and home care costs. It can also cover intangible losses, like pain and suffering. Mesothelioma lawyers may be able to help you determine the amount of compensation.

    The most common asbestos claims are personal injury and wrongful death lawsuits. A top mesothelioma lawyer can examine your case at no cost and recommend the most suitable type of compensation claim to submit. They will collect evidence, including your employment background and dates of asbestos exposure. They will also be able access large databases of asbestos-producing firms.

    As the dangers of asbestos became widely known, many companies that produced asbestos-containing products filed for bankruptcy. To ensure that their victims were compensated companies set up asbestos trust funds. These funds, which total approximately $30 billion can be used to compensate mesothelioma patients without the need to go to court. On average, mesothelioma settlements and jury verdicts are more than asbestos trust fund payments.

    Certain victims and their families could be eligible for financial assistance through government programs, in addition to suing, or establishing an asbestos trust fund. Veterans who have been diagnosed with asbestos-related ailments can receive disability benefits from the U.S. Department of Veterans Affairs. This compensation is based on the severity of the mesothelioma or another asbestos lawyer - this hyperlink,-related illness.

    Families of mesothelioma patients may also be qualified for compensation in wrongful death or estate claims. Asbestos patients may be eligible for community assistance or other benefits through their employer or military.

    A mesothelioma lawyer will explain the different types of compensation that are available and help you determine if you are eligible to make a lawsuit or a trust fund claim. A lawyer can also assist you gather the evidence needed to prove your mesothelioma exposure. They can assist you in submitting the proper paperwork and make sure that it is filed within the right time frame.

    It may be challenging to file a claim, but the effort is usually worth it. Asbestos victims deserve compensation for the negligence of companies which exposed them to this deadly substance. Compensation can help patients get the best treatments available and provide their families with financial security in the future.
